Bedside Unit

Critical Warning
Messages

Lower Limit ____
Upper Limit ____

Notes that appear at the
patient test result screen
when the test result falls
outside the critical limits.
The notes are intended to
offer suggestions for
abnormal results.
The upper and lower limits
of the range for patient
results as defined by your
institution.

Patient Message
Entry Required (for
results outside
critical limits)

❍ Yes
❍ No

If a patient test result falls
outside the critical limits,
you may be required to
select a comment which
corresponds to the patient’s
current situation.

Configuration Option

Meaning

❑ BU lockout if no

upload in ____
days

If selected, the bedside
unit cannot be used for
testing if a data transfer
session has not been
performed within the
specified number of days
(maximum of 60 days).

❑ Bedside unit

beeper on

If selected, optional
bedside unit beeps are
enabled.

❑ Enable barcode

scanner

If selected, the bedside
unit barcode scanner is
enabled. If not selected,
you must enter all ID and
lot number information
manually.
